Openers: There is no confusion - It must be Sehwag and Hayden. Though Langer gives tough competition. Middle order slection is toughest: so many classy middle order batsmen in this decade. Dravid,kallis,ponting,SRT, sanga, mahila, yousuf , Lara, Laxman- tough to select only 4. ponting is highest run getter in this decade, so he is in. Kallis with his all round abilities should be in . Dravid has been exceptional performer for India for long time in this decade and he is second highest run getter of this decade., so he must be in. For the fourth position, tough to pick one I'll have to look up stats. Runs against non-minnows in this decade. http://stats.cricinfo.com/ci/engine/stats/index.html?class=1;filter=advanced;opposition=1;opposition=140;opposition=2;opposition=3;opposition=4;opposition=5;opposition=6;opposition=7;opposition=8;orderby=runs;spanmin1=1+jan+2000;spanval1=span;template=results;type=batting Mahila is better than Sanga in terms of avg and runs , but Sanga was very consistent whereas Mahila,SRT and yousuf went though some bad patches so they were not as consistent as Sanga. Also picking Sanga as keeper would allow me to pick one more all rounder. So Sanga is 4th middle order batsman and Wicket keeper. Now bowling allrounder position: Pollock and Freddie are contenders. Though Freddie is exceptional when is fit, he is injury prone,pollock is more reliable , Though pollock is more reliable and has taken more wickets than Freddie, Freddie is match winner on his day. Moreover we've Mcgrath who is a line and length bowler, so Freddie, a hit the deck bolwer, is better than pollock who is similar to Mcgrath. Two pacers: Mcgrath is in. He was a class apart. Many contender for another pace position: Lee, Akhtar, steyn, ntini , bond, Zalk etc. I'd like to have a tearaway fast bowler for this position , so Lee would be my choice. He was a good bowler during Mcgrath era and He spearheaded Australian attack after McGrath retirement. He has highest no of wickets in this decade after mcgrath against non-minnows. Steyn is good, but he is relatively new , bond and Akhtar have been inconsistent due to non-cricketing issues. so my choice would be Lee. Two spinners : no hesitation to pick Warne and Murali. So Here it goes: Viru Hayden Dravid Ponting Kallis Sangakkara Freddie Lee Mcgrath Warne Murali
